Transaction 101dec290e21d1568c63f9863a68ddbf714b8c4a56f9ef53c3c633d35f2471f9

1 Input
2 Outputs
  • 101dec290e21d1568c63f9863a68ddbf714b8c4a56f9ef53c3c633d35f2471f9:0
  • value  1004608
    address  12Ain2M7s9qYthHU3BUoKuY4YnauuHaz1u
  • 101dec290e21d1568c63f9863a68ddbf714b8c4a56f9ef53c3c633d35f2471f9:1
  • value  233586
    address  1LXcadVREs83FHbmqPsnHuq4iZZcWmtvLW